%% Clusterisation and multi-node testing
%%
-type cluster_spec() :: [node_spec()].
-type node_spec() :: role() | {role(), shortname()} | {role(), shortname(), node_opts()}.
-type role() :: core | replicant.
-type shortname() :: atom().
-type nodename() :: atom().
-type node_opts() :: #{
%% Need to loaded apps. These apps will be loaded once the node started
load_apps => list(),
%% Need to started apps. It is the first arg passed to emqx_common_test_helpers:start_apps/2
apps => list(),
%% Extras app starting handler. It is the second arg passed to emqx_common_test_helpers:start_apps/2
env_handler => fun((AppName :: atom()) -> term()),
%% Application env preset before calling `emqx_common_test_helpers:start_apps/2`
env => {AppName :: atom(), Key :: atom(), Val :: term()},
%% Whether to execute `emqx_config:init_load(SchemaMod)`
%% default: true
load_schema => boolean(),
%% Eval by emqx_config:put/2
conf => [{KeyPath :: list(), Val :: term()}],
%% Fast option to config listener port
%% default rule:
%% - tcp: base_port
%% - ssl: base_port + 1
%% - ws : base_port + 3
%% - wss: base_port + 4
listener_ports => [{Type :: tcp | ssl | ws | wss, inet:port_number()}]
}.
